Blatner & Fraser's "Real World Photoshop CS" covers a lot of printing among other things. Much of the printing section, though, covers CMYK, color seperation, screening, etc. Not as much on home/inkjet printing.

It's a great book and highly recommended, but this may not be the book you're thinking about.
